Pull up a bar stool in Cheers Beacon Hill, the pub that provided the inspiration for the hit 1980s TV show “Cheers.” Bibliophiles will want to check out the Boston Athenaeum, an exquisitely decorated and furnished private library that overlooks the Granary Burying Grounds. Pick up that perfect Boston memento from one of the many antique and craft shops on Charles Street, Beacon Hill’s main thoroughfare. Additionally, look out for Mount Vernon Street and Louisburg Square, two of the most exclusive addresses in Boston. Acorn Street is one of the area’s most picturesque and frequently photographed streets. Pick up a coffee from one of many cafés and wander the cobblestone streets at your leisure. Look for polished brass door knockers, which have become the unofficial symbol of the suburb. They range from narrow row houses to grand family residences. Most homes were built in the 18th and 19th centuries and are lovingly preserved. The Beacon Hill area was settled in 1625. Federal-style row houses are dressed with pretty flower boxes and wrought iron fences. Streets are lined with cobblestone sidewalks and flickering gas lamps. Historic Beacon Hill is one of Boston’s smallest suburbs, but it sure packs in a lot of charm. Lose yourself in the charming streetscapes, historic buildings and village-like atmosphere of Boston’s oldest and wealthiest suburbs.
